description             GPS service daemon

long_description        GPSD is a service daemon that handles GPSes and other \
                        navigation-related sensors reporting over USB, serial, \
                        TCP/IP, or UDP connections and presents reports in \
                        a well-documented JSON format.  The package also \
                        includes a number of clients which can be run against \
                        a local GPSD or a GPSD on another machine.

# Allow the regression tests to be run via "port test gpsd".
#
# The speed of the daemon tests is highly dependent on the WRITE_PAD value,
# but values that are too low may cause spurious test failures. Due to some
# recent improvements, 1ms is now believed to be adequate on the Mac in most
# cases, and is the current upstream default.  But some test flakiness has
# been observed on some systems with this value, so we increase it here to
# 10ms.
#
# The WRITE_PAD value is obtained from test.write_pad, which can be overridden
# on the command line if needed.  This replaces the older approach of specifying
# the WRITE_PAD environment variable directly, not only avoiding the need
# to whitelist WRITE_PAD in extra_env, but also to avoid trouble with older
# versions of sudo that don't support -E.
#
# The test phase duplicates the arguments and environment (except WRITE_PAD)
# from the build phase, mainly to avoid gratuitous rebuilds between the phases.
#
# The GPSD build procedure supports parallel tests, but there's no built-in
# MacPorts support for parallel tests, nor is there a standard test.jobs
# variable, so we derive test.jobs from build.jobs.  If test parallelism
# is suspected of causing trouble, test.jobs can be overridden on the
# command line.
#
test.run                yes
default test.jobs       ${build.jobs}
test.cmd                ${build.cmd} -j${test.jobs}
test.target             testregress
test.args               {*}${build.args}
test.env                {*}${build.env}
default test.write_pad  0.01
test.env-append         WRITE_PAD=${test.write_pad}
